  • Abstract
    We propose a method of correcting phase distortion which is caused when measuring any objects by phase shifting method with an ordinary projector. We have measured some objects with the projector which is commercially available [1]. In this paper, we try to improve the precision with the proposing method. The method calculates differences between the idealized phase and observed, and then feeding back the error to the observed phase. By using this method, the precision could be made better by 47%.
